Przeglądaj źródła

1.修改iOS RAImage相机调用。

Pen Li 7 lat temu
rodzic
commit
e02ef54b28
1 zmienionych plików z 4 dodań i 6 usunięć
  1. 4 6
      RA Image/RA Image/BasicModeViewController.m

+ 4 - 6
RA Image/RA Image/BasicModeViewController.m

@@ -238,8 +238,7 @@
     }
     
     __weak typeof(self) weakself = self;
-    RACameraViewController *cameraVC = [RACameraViewController viewControllerFromStoryboard];
-    cameraVC.completion = ^(UIImage *img) {
+    RACameraViewController *cameraVC = [RACameraViewController showCameraFromViewController:self withTakeMode:RACameraTakeModeTakeASerial videoGravity:AVLayerVideoGravityResizeAspect completion:^(UIImage *img) {
         
         if (img) {
             dispatch_async(dispatch_get_global_queue(0, 0), ^{
@@ -258,16 +257,15 @@
                         [weakself.photos insertObject:photoDic atIndex:0];
                         weakself.photoCount++;
                     } else {
-//                        [RAUtils message_alert:@"Save photo failed, storage full?" title:@"Warning" controller:weakPreVC];
+                        //                        [RAUtils message_alert:@"Save photo failed, storage full?" title:@"Warning" controller:weakPreVC];
                     }
                 });
                 
             });
         }
         
-    };
-    cameraVC.takeMode = RACameraTakeModeTakeASerial;
-    cameraVC.fromVC = self;
+    }];
+    
     [self.navigationController pushViewController:cameraVC animated:YES];
     
 //    UIImagePickerController *imgPicker = [[UIImagePickerController alloc] init];